Formula
- Heat input HI = (η × V × I) / travel speed
- HI in kJ/mm when travel speed is mm/min and η is thermal efficiency
- Arc power = V × I / 1000 kW

How it works
Heat input equals thermal efficiency times voltage times current divided by travel speed. Arc power shows instantaneous welding power. Cooling rate and preheat estimates use plate thickness, material type, and ambient temperature heuristics. Warning flags heat input above typical process limits.

Worked example
SMAW 25 V, 150 A, 300 mm/min travel, η = 0.75.
- Travel = 300/60 = 5 mm/s
- HI = 0.75 × 25 × 150 / (5 × 1000) = 0.563 kJ/mm
- Arc power = 3.75 kW
- Below SMAW limit 3.5 kJ/mm → Within limit
Result: Heat input 0.56 kJ/mm, within process limit.

FAQ
- What is thermal efficiency η?
- Fraction of arc energy deposited in the plate. SMAW ~0.75, GMAW ~0.80, GTAW ~0.60, SAW ~0.95 — use your WPS value.
- Why did preheat show zero?
- For thin plate at moderate heat input, calculated preheat may round to zero. Increase thickness or lower heat input to see preheat rise.
- What triggers Above limit?
- Heat input exceeds a typical maximum for the selected process. High heat input can reduce HAZ toughness.
